Java 数组与函数:高级操作指南212
在 Java 中,数组和函数是两种强大的工具,可以显著提升代码的可读性和效率。本文将深入探讨 Java 数组和函数的用法,提供高级操作技巧和最佳实践,帮助您编写更清晰、更有效的代码。
Java 数组
1. 声明和初始化
要声明 Java 数组,请使用以下语法:int[] arr = new int[size];
其中,`size` 是数组的大小。例如,要声明一个包含 5 个整数元素的数组,可以使用以下代码:int[] arr = new int[5];
要初始化数组元素,可以在声明时使用大括号:int[] arr = {1, 2, 3, 4, 5};
2. 数组操作
一旦数组声明,可以使用以下方法对其进行操作:* 获取数组长度:``
* 访问数组元素:`arr[index]`
* 遍历数组:使用 for 循环或 foreach 循环
* 排序数组:`(arr)`
* 搜索数组:`(arr, value)`
3. 多维数组
Java 还可以创建多维数组。例如,一个二维数组可以用以下方式声明:int[][] matrix = new int[rows][cols];
其中,`rows` 是行数,`cols` 是列数。
Java 函数
1. 定义和调用
Java 函数(也称为方法)用于封装代码并执行特定任务。要定义函数,请使用以下语法:public static void functionName(parameters) {
// 代码
}
要调用函数,只需使用其名称和参数:functionName(arguments);
2. 函数参数
函数可以接受参数,参数是传递给函数的数据。参数在函数定义中声明,并可以在函数体中使用。
3. 函数返回值
函数可以返回一个值,其类型在函数定义中指定。要返回一个值,请使用 `return` 语句。
4. 最佳实践
编写 Java 函数时,请遵循以下最佳实践:* 命名规则:使用有意义的名称,描述函数的用途。
* 文档:使用 JavaDoc 注释记录函数,说明其作用、参数和返回值。
* 可复用性:编写可复用的函数,以便在多个地方使用。
* 错误处理:处理函数中可能发生的错误并提供有意义的错误消息。
Java 数组和函数的结合应用
Java 数组和函数可以结合使用以创建强大的解决方案。例如,您可以将函数用于以下目的:* 初始化数组:编写一个函数来初始化数组中的元素。
* 搜索数组:编写一个函数来搜索数组中的特定元素。
* 对数组进行排序:编写一个函数来对数组中的元素进行排序。
* 操作多维数组:编写一个函数来操作多维数组中的元素。
Java 数组和函数是面向对象编程的强大工具。通过理解这些工具并遵循最佳实践,您可以编写更清晰、更有效的代码。通过实践和应用,您将能够掌握 Java 数组和函数的全部功能,从而为您的软件开发项目增添价值。
2024-10-29
上一篇:Java 数组随机化:全面指南
Python兔子代码:从ASCII艺术到复杂模拟的奇妙之旅
https://www.shuihudhg.cn/134269.html
Python字符串与列表的转换艺术:全面解析与实战指南
https://www.shuihudhg.cn/134268.html
PHP 高效处理ZIP文件:从读取、解压到内容提取的完全指南
https://www.shuihudhg.cn/134267.html
Java数据模板设计深度解析:构建灵活可维护的数据结构
https://www.shuihudhg.cn/134266.html
极客深潜Python数据科学:解锁高效与洞察力的秘籍
https://www.shuihudhg.cn/134265.html
热门文章
Java中数组赋值的全面指南
https://www.shuihudhg.cn/207.html
JavaScript 与 Java:二者有何异同?
https://www.shuihudhg.cn/6764.html
判断 Java 字符串中是否包含特定子字符串
https://www.shuihudhg.cn/3551.html
Java 字符串的切割:分而治之
https://www.shuihudhg.cn/6220.html
Java 输入代码:全面指南
https://www.shuihudhg.cn/1064.html